New Hampshire Senate District 19 split nearly evenly in the 2024 presidential race, with a 0.7-point Republican edge across a population of roughly 59,000 — making it one of the state's most competitive legislative battlegrounds.

The Democratic margin in New Hampshire 19th State Senate District has rarely exceeded two points in modern history; the Republican margin has rarely exceeded six points. 2024 delivered the district to the Republican candidate by two points.

Its demographics resemble the country more than they resemble most districts. A 91% non-Hispanic-white share, a 5% poverty rate, and a median household income of $118,331 — all within the broad national range.

How did State Senate District 19, New Hampshire vote in 2024?
In 2024, State Senate District 19, New Hampshire voted Republican by 2.4 points (R+2), carried by the Republican candidate. Out of 37,605 votes cast, 18,089 went Democratic and 19,002 went Republican.
What is State Senate District 19, New Hampshire's political archetype?
Akashic classifies State Senate District 19, New Hampshire as a "Bellwether" district based on its long-arc presidential voting pattern. Across 5 elections in the dataset, the district has voted Democratic 2 times, Republican 3 times, and other 0 times.
When did State Senate District 19, New Hampshire last vote Democratic?
The most recent presidential election in which State Senate District 19, New Hampshire voted Democratic was 2020.
How many people live in State Senate District 19, New Hampshire?
State Senate District 19, New Hampshire has a population of 59,132 according to the 2024 American Community Survey 5-year estimates from the US Census Bureau.
What is the median household income in State Senate District 19, New Hampshire?
Median household income in State Senate District 19, New Hampshire is $118,331 — above the national median of $80,734. The New Hampshire state median is $99,031.
What is the political history of State Senate District 19, New Hampshire?
Akashic tracks 5 presidential elections in State Senate District 19, New Hampshire from 2008 to 2024. Of those, 2 went Democratic and 3 went Republican. The district's archetype — "Bellwether" — captures the overall trajectory of that voting record.
